Output ebd8b306b0a120b377420810bb947a97c4638872b33699105fdb1b251ef4636a:1

value
1257236
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1882f285d233b0a640a3df62eff18ceb0254dbda OP_EQUALVERIFY OP_CHECKSIG
address
13Ec5zAdmdtbNs7ayLSZBCBu52QxtzCJAc
transaction
ebd8b306b0a120b377420810bb947a97c4638872b33699105fdb1b251ef4636a
confirmations
554021
spent
true